Oby Ndukwe, the publisher of the Beam newspaper, has voiced her thoughts regarding President Bola Tinubu’s suggested resolution for the Rivers state crisis. She stated that such matters ought to have been resolved in private and that there was no need for the public revelation. She said that outside intervention might have been prevented if Governor Fubara had broadcast sooner about sticking to the resolution. She said in an interview with Arise TV, ”As far as I’m concerned, the parties involved have decided to resolve their matter. Ordinarily, this ought not to have been in the public domain. It’s something that they could have as well handled. And if Fubara had made this broadcast earlier, the people meddling in now wouldn’t be there. It’s just that the delay now offered them the opportunity to do what they are doing. And that is why they are not stopping even when the man has come out to say, look I align with Every letter and spirit of that resolution. I mean, it shouldn’t be our problem.
